MongoDB Search Made Easy with Readymade Templates for Full-text, Vector, Semantic and Hybrid Search

Introduzione alla Ricerca Avanzata con MongoDB e BuildShip

La costruzione di funzionalità di ricerca avanzate è diventata più accessibile grazie all'integrazione tra MongoDB e BuildShip. Questo tutorial illustra come impostare MongoDB Atlas, costruire flussi di lavoro per la ricerca full-text e implementare la ricerca semantica utilizzando un approccio low-code.

Configurazione di MongoDB Atlas: Il primo passo consiste nell'impostare un cluster MongoDB su MongoDB Atlas. Questo servizio cloud offre una gestione semplificata del database, consentendo agli sviluppatori di concentrarsi sulla logica applicativa.

1. Creare un account su MongoDB Atlas e configurare un nuovo cluster.

2. Inizializzare un database e collezioni all'interno del cluster.

3. Configurare le impostazioni di sicurezza, inclusi gli accessi e le regole di rete.

Creazione di Indici di Ricerca: Per migliorare le prestazioni delle query di ricerca, è essenziale creare indici di ricerca appropriati.

1. Creare indici full-text per consentire ricerche rapide e accurate all'interno dei documenti.

2. Configurare indici vettoriali per supportare la ricerca basata su vettori, utile per applicazioni di machine learning.

3. Implementare indici semantici per migliorare la comprensione del contesto nelle query di ricerca.

Configurazione dei Flussi di Lavoro con BuildShip: BuildShip offre un approccio low-code per costruire e automatizzare flussi di lavoro complessi.

1. Integrare MongoDB con BuildShip utilizzando connettori predefiniti.

2. Creare flussi di lavoro per la ricerca full-text, vettoriale e semantica utilizzando template predefiniti.

3. Configurare flussi di lavoro ibridi che combinano diverse tecniche di ricerca per ottenere risultati più accurati.

Come possono queste tecniche di ricerca avanzata migliorare l'efficienza delle applicazioni moderne?

Idee: Ricerca Avanzata in Azione

  • Implementazione di un motore di ricerca per e-commerce che utilizza la ricerca full-text per trovare prodotti.
  • Utilizzo della ricerca vettoriale per raccomandazioni personalizzate basate sul comportamento degli utenti.
  • Applicazione della ricerca semantica per migliorare la pertinenza dei risultati nelle query di assistenti virtuali.

Conclusione: L'integrazione di MongoDB con BuildShip semplifica la costruzione di funzionalità di ricerca avanzate, migliorando l'efficienza e la produttività degli sviluppatori. Con l'approccio low-code, è possibile implementare rapidamente soluzioni di ricerca potenti e scalabili.

AI-Repo (GPT)

1 year 9 months ago Read time: 2 minutes
L'integrazione dell'intelligenza artificiale in strumenti quotidiani e tecnologie avanzate sta trasformando il panorama tecnologico attuale. OpenAI e Ollama hanno migliorato l'efficienza delle chiamate di funzione del 20% e la precisione del 15%, mentre l'integrazione di Claude con Google Sheets ha aumentato la produttività del 25% e ridotto l'intervento manuale del 30%. NVIDIA, con NeRF-XL, ha incrementato il realismo delle simulazioni virtuali del 40% e l'efficienza del 35%. I modelli locali con GraphRAG hanno ridotto i costi del 20% e migliorato l'estrazione di entità del 10%. Apple AI, come assistente personale, ha aumentato la produttività del 30% con un focus sulla privacy. Queste innovazioni non solo migliorano l'efficienza e riducono i costi, ma aprono anche nuove opportunità di sviluppo, come l'integrazione di capacità AI avanzate in strumenti di produttività e la creazione di assistenti AI personalizzati. La rapida evoluzione dell'AI richiede un costante aggiornamento delle competenze e una riflessione sulle implicazioni etiche.
1 year 9 months ago Read time: 3 minutes
L'intelligenza artificiale si evolve nel presente, ottimizzando funzioni e migliorando la produttività. Scopri come l'autologica e le nuove tecnologie AI stanno trasformando strumenti quotidiani e aprendo nuove frontiere nella simulazione 3D.